So, with regard to your query, YES, you can use 12th standard admit card as an identity proof for the purpose of NEET application form.
As per criteria provided by NTA agency, candidates can use PAN Card, Driving License, Voter ID, 12th standard admit card or registration card, Passport, Aadhar card, Ration Card etc.,. The agency mentioned that, candidate must produce an original valid photo identification proof issued by government.

For your reference I am mentioning down the syllabus of NEET UG :-
@Physics
> Physical world and measurement
> Electrostatics
> Kinematics
> Current Electricity
> Laws of Motion
> Magnetic Effects of Current and Magnetism
> Work, Energy and Power
> Electromagnetic Induction and Alternating Currents
> Motion of System of Particles and Rigid Body
> Electromagnetic Waves
> Gravitation
> Optics
> Properties of Bulk Matter
> Dual Nature of Matter and Radiation
> Thermodynamics, Oscillations and Waves
> Atoms and Nuclei
> Behaviour of Perfect Gas and Kinetic Theory
> Electronic Devices
@Chemistry
> Some Basic Concepts of Chemistry
> Solid State
> Structure of Atom
> Solutions
> Classification of Elements and Periodicity in Properties
> Electrochemistry
> Chemical Bonding and Molecular Structure
> Chemical Kinetics
> States of Matter: Gases and Liquids
> Surface Chemistry
> Thermodynamics
> General Principles and Processes of Isolation of Elements
> Equilibrium
> p-Block Elements
> Redox Reactions
> d and f Block Elements
> Hydrogen
> Coordination Compounds
> s-Block Element (Alkali and Alkaline earth metals)
> Haloalkanes and Haloarenes
> Some p-Block Elements
> Alcohols, Phenols and Ethers
> Organic Chemistry- Some Basic Principles and Techniques
> Aldehydes, Ketones and Carboxylic Acids
> Hydrocarbons
> Organic Compounds Containing Nitrogen
> Environmental Chemistry
> Biomolecules, Polymers and Chemistry in Everyday Life
@Biology
> Diversity in Living World
> Reproduction
> Structural Organization in Animals and Plants
> Genetics and Evolution
> Cell Structure and Function
> Biology and Human Welfare
> Plant Physiology
> Biotechnology and Its Application
> Human Physiology
> Ecology and Environment

SSC conducts CGL at graduation level and SSC CHSL is mainly for those who have passed 10+2 from a recognized board, I assume you want to know about SSC CGL as admit card for SSC CGL was released on 7th April, the tier 1 exam is going to be conducted from 11th to 21st April,
just visit the official website at https://ssc.nic.in/portal/admitcard, click on your region that is the one you belong to, further you will be directed towards the website where you can view the link to download admit card, click on it, there after you have to enter details like registration number/dob, submit the same, if you don't remember your registration number, there is alternative option of putting in your name. your father's name and dob, you can also access your admit card via this route, download it and take a print out of few copies for future references, make sure all the details are correct in it, as from your profile it seems you belong to Karnataka, so you can also directly visit at https://ssckkr.kar.nic.in/sschallticket/cgl_2020_login.aspx to download your admit card, in case you're appearing from other region, follow the process I mentioned above.
